Bamboo removal is a tough however needed task for maintaining landscape control and preventing structural damage. Bamboo spreads rapidly through roots, which can infiltrate lawns, garden beds, and even foundations if left untreated. Total elimination requires both above-ground cutting and cautious excavation of underground roots to prevent regrowth. Manual removal involves digging up rhizomes and stumps, while chemical treatments may be applied to hinder regrowth. Repeated monitoring is vital, as even little fragments of roots can produce brand-new shoots. Proper disposal of removed bamboo prevents it from restoring in other places on the residential or commercial property. After elimination, soil repair and replanting with non-invasive species help reclaim the affected location and bring back landscape aesthetics. Bamboo management guarantees long-term control, protects surrounding plants, and prevents damage to structures and hardscape aspects
